首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
Mrz不想说话
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
20
文章 20
沸点 0
赞
20
返回
|
搜索文章
赞
文章( 20 )
沸点( 0 )
Java 混淆那些事(六):Android 混淆的那些琐事
今天我们这一篇是「Java 混淆那些事」系列的第六篇,咱们针对 Android 平台来写。非 Android 开发者可以跳过此篇文章。 我们这个系列都是基于 ProGuard 6.0 的,而 Android SDK 提供的 ProGuard 比较低。新版本加上的几个操作符无法使…
PickerView 2.0版本强势来袭
还记得这可能是史上最好用的PickerView库了这篇文章吗? 今天它强势升级归来了。
浅谈跨平台框架 Flutter 的优势与结构
目前,移动开发技术主要分为原生开发和跨平台开发两种。其中,原生应用是指在某个特定的移动平台上,使用平台所支持的开发工具和语言,直接调用系统提供的API所开发的应用。 2.原生应用的速度快、性能高,而且可以实现比较复杂的动画和绘制效果,用户体验较好。 2.有新的功能需要更新时,只…
提升效率——自动加固并上传到蒲公英
我们的应用在发布的时候一般都需要进行加固和生成多渠道包,大家通常的做法应该是下载加固客户端,或者将 apk 文件上传到加固服务的管理后台进行加固,然后等着加固完成,再下载安装包文件。 本文基于 使用 Gradle 实现一套代码开发多个应用 中的 Gradle 配置进行迭代开发,…
Java 混淆那些事(二):认识 ProGuard GUI
这篇「Java 混淆那些事」的第二篇,我们先把我们的测试环境以及用到的各种工具介绍一下,然后动手去尝试各种命令并且验证它们的效果,这样有助于我们理解。 首先需要在电脑上配置好 Java 环境。然后需要的主角 ProGuard,然后还有反编译软件 jadx。 下载链接在下面。 第…
Java 混淆那些事(一):重新认识 ProGuard
大家好,你现在看到的是「Java 混淆那些事」系列文章的第一篇,通过这个系列我想带大家重新认识一下 ProGuard 到底能干什么?最终领悟怎么才能写好混淆规则。所以说这个系列文章的重点将会放到书写 keep 规则上面。我会最大程度用大白话写明白。 压缩 (Shrinker):…
Android-Application详解
Base class for maintaining global application state. You can provide your own implementation by creating a subclass and specifying the full…
从零到一发布 Android 开源库
本文意在提供发布 Android 开源库一条龙教程。库的重点是代码,发布只是个必须的过程。希望能帮助你将精心打造的库很快的开源出去。只因国内相关文章很少,故此挖坑。
Android 中 Application 类的全面总结
最近的开发中经常使用到 Application 类,它的用处很多,但是网上的资料有很多是旧的或者是介绍不全的,在这里全面总结一下,先介绍 Application 的所有方法,再介绍它的使用经验。
[译]Android Application 启动流程分析
为了便于阅读, 应邀将 Android App 性能优化系列, 转移到掘金原创上来. 掘金的新出的 "收藏集" 功能可以用来做系列文集了. 这是一篇关于 Android Application 启动流程分析的译文, 为我们后面讲 App 启动优化打个基础. 译者注: 原文分成两个部分, 链接如下:…
下一页
关注了
14
关注者
1
收藏集
3
关注标签
5
加入于
2018-12-19